Reference specification
| Item | Value |
|---|---|
| Model | Mesh Pro |
| Brand | Freemax |
| Category | Pod Systems |
| Battery | 900 mAh |
| Output range | 10-30 W |
| Capacity | 2.0 ml |
| Charging | Magnetic dock |
| Coil options | 0.6 / 0.8 / 1.0 ohm |
| Carton quantity | 200 units |

Frequently asked questions
Which channel suits Mesh Pro best?
Specialist retail for range depth, convenience for volume of core SKUs, online for long tail flavours.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
